Reusing reference sample memory based on flexible partition type
Abstract:
A method for video decoding includes determining, based on prediction information, whether the current block uses a flexible partition type. Reconstructed samples of the reference block are stored in a cache memory, which stores reconstructed samples of coding regions of a first size comprising a coding tree unit (CTU) of the current block and reconstructed samples of at least one coding region of the first size comprising a CTU adjacent to the CTU of the current block. The cache memory stores either (i) only reconstructed samples of the coding regions of the CTU of the current block or (ii) reconstructed samples of coding regions of a second size of the CTU of the current block and reconstructed samples of at least one coding region of the second size of the CTU adjacent to the CTU of the current block.
